Liam Byrne
At a glance
Liam Byrne is currently a Labour MP for Birmingham Hodge Hill and Solihull North, and has represented the constituency for 22 years, 1 months. The latest election majority is 1,566. They are most active voting on Tax. They have voted in 65.6 % of eligible Commons divisions, compared with a Commons average of 72.7 %. For financial year 2024-25, Liam Byrne submitted £280,258 of expenses, which is 24 % higher than the average MP. Asked 108 parliamentary questions in the last 12 months.
